免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果证书与开发者账号

苹果证书和开发者账号是开发者在苹果公司开发和发布应用程序所必须的两个重要元素。在了解它们的原理和详细介绍之前,需要先了解一些相关的概念。

什么是苹果证书?

苹果证书是用于证明应用程序开发者身份的数字证书。苹果证书是由苹果公司颁发的,用于验证应用程序的身份和签名。在开发 iOS 和 macOS 应用程序时,需要使用苹果证书来打包和签名应用程序,以便在 App Store 上发布应用程序。

什么是开发者账号?

开发者账号是用于在苹果公司注册和管理开发者身份的账号。开发者账号可以让开发者在苹果公司开发和发布应用程序。开发者账号需要支付一定的费用,每年需要更新一次。

苹果证书和开发者账号的原理

苹果证书和开发者账号都是为了保证应用程序的安全性和可信度。苹果证书用于验证应用程序的身份和签名,确保应用程序没有被篡改或修改。开发者账号则用于验证开发者的身份和权限,确保应用程序的开发者是合法的,有权利发布应用程序。

苹果证书和开发者账号的使用

在开发 iOS 和 macOS 应用程序时,需要使用苹果证书和开发者账号来打包和签名应用程序,以便在 App Store 上发布应用程序。下面是使用苹果证书和开发者账号的步骤:

1. 注册和申请开发者账号

首先需要注册和申请开发者账号,以便在苹果公司开发和发布应用程序。注册开发者账号需要支付一定的费用,并需要提供一些个人信息和证明文件。

2. 创建和下载苹果证书

在注册开发者账号之后,需要创建和下载苹果证书。苹果证书可以在苹果开发者中心网站上创建和下载。创建苹果证书需要提供一些个人信息和证明文件,以便证明应用程序开发者的身份和合法性。

3. 使用苹果证书打包和签名应用程序

在创建和下载苹果证书之后,需要使用苹果证书来打包和签名应用程序。打包和签名应用程序可以使用 Xcode 工具,也可以使用命令行工具。打包和签名应用程序后,可以将应用程序上传到 App Store 上发布。

总结

苹果证书和开发者账号是开发者在苹果公司开发和发布应用程序所必须的两个重要元素。苹果证书用于验证应用程序的身份和签名,开发者账号用于验证开发者的身份和权限。使用苹果证书和开发者账号可以保证应用程序的安全性和可信度,确保应用程序没有被篡改或修改。


相关知识:
苹果重签名过期是什么意思
苹果重签名过期是指在使用越狱工具或者开发者账号创建的应用程序在一定时间后会过期,需要进行重签名操作才能继续使用。本文将从原理和详细介绍两个方面来解释苹果重签名过期的意思。一、原理在苹果设备上,应用程序必须经过签名才能被安装和运行。签名是指将应用程序和开发者
2023-04-07
苹果证书全部无法验证
苹果证书无法验证的现象通常是由于证书失效或者被吊销导致的。在苹果设备上,证书验证是非常重要的一项安全措施,它可以确保应用程序或者服务端的身份和完整性。如果证书无法验证,那么就会导致应用程序无法正常运行或者连接到对应的服务端。下面将详细介绍苹果证书无法验证的
2023-04-07
苹果系统签名软件
苹果系统签名软件是一种用于验证应用程序和软件的安全性的工具。这种软件可以为应用程序和软件添加数字签名,以证明它们是经过认证和授权的,从而保证用户的安全和隐私。苹果系统签名软件的原理是使用数字证书来验证应用程序和软件的身份。数字证书是一种由权威机构颁发的电子
2023-04-07
苹果消息推送证书
苹果消息推送证书是一种用于 iOS 和 macOS 应用程序的安全证书,可以让应用程序向用户发送推送通知。这些通知可以包含文本、声音和图像,可以帮助应用程序与用户进行实时交互和提醒。在本文中,我们将详细介绍苹果消息推送证书的原理和使用方法。一、原理苹果消息
2023-04-07
苹果应用签名特点
苹果应用签名是指开发者在发布应用时,将应用程序进行数字签名,以保证应用程序的完整性和安全性。苹果应用签名的特点主要有以下几点:1. 数字签名苹果应用签名采用的是数字签名技术。数字签名是一种利用公钥加密技术,将文件的摘要信息与开发者的私钥进行加密,生成一个数
2023-04-07
永久签名ios
永久签名iOS指的是在不需要连接电脑的情况下,使得iOS设备上安装的应用程序能够长期使用,而不会因为签名过期而无法运行。这种签名方式可以避免应用程序在使用一段时间后无法运行的问题,同时也可以让用户方便地使用自己喜欢的应用程序。iOS应用程序的签名是为了保证
2023-04-07
未签名怎么安装到苹果手机上
在苹果手机上,只有通过App Store下载的应用才能被安装并运行,这是由于苹果公司的安全机制所决定的。然而,有些应用可能由于各种原因没有通过App Store审核或者涉及到越狱等操作,这时候就需要通过未签名安装的方式来安装这些应用。未签名安装的原理是利用
2023-04-07
在线检测ios证书
iOS证书主要用于开发者在发布应用程序时进行身份验证和数字签名。在开发过程中,开发者需要通过Apple Developer网站申请证书,并将证书安装到开发机器和移动设备上。但是在使用过程中,开发者可能会遇到证书过期、证书被吊销等问题,这时需要进行证书的在线
2023-04-07
为什么必须做苹果签名
在iOS设备上安装第三方应用程序需要经过苹果签名的过程,这是因为苹果公司为了保护用户的设备安全,采取了一系列措施,其中之一便是限制了第三方应用程序的安装。苹果签名是苹果公司对应用程序进行数字签名的过程,是iOS设备安全机制的重要组成部分。苹果签名的原理是基
2023-04-07
苹果app为什么签名过期
苹果的iOS系统对App的签名是有时间限制的,一般为一年左右。当签名过期后,用户在打开应用时会出现“无法验证此应用”的提示,导致无法正常使用。那么,为什么苹果的App签名会过期呢?这里我们来介绍一下原理。首先,需要了解的是,苹果的App Store是一个封
2023-04-07
ios开发者证书共享
iOS开发者证书是苹果公司为开发者提供的一种身份认证方式,开发者可以使用这个证书来发布自己的iOS应用程序。然而,每个开发者只能有一个开发者证书,而且这个证书只能绑定一个开发者账号,这就导致了一些问题。如果一个团队有多个开发者,那么每个开发者都需要有自己的
2023-04-07
ios已验证了证书
在iOS的开发过程中,证书是一个非常重要的概念。iOS开发者需要使用证书来验证应用程序的身份和真实性,以确保应用程序能够在iOS设备上运行。本文将详细介绍iOS证书的原理和验证过程。一、iOS证书的原理iOS证书是由苹果公司颁发的数字证书,用于验证应用程序
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4